Bridal Wedding Dress

The bridal wedding dress might be the most difficult thing to find for a bride-to-be because everyone wants to find the perfect one for their once-in-life time. What if you have difficulty in make decisions between two gowns? This happens. What if you want to put on all the dresses that you like the most on the wedding day? This though is also normal. In this article, I will share some tips that should save you such trouble and headache so that you can enjoy your wedding to the utmost degree.

The first tip is that you should start looking for the bridal wedding dress as early as possible, which is the most important thing you should do. It will not only give you enough time to look around and make you choice at your own pace, but also leave time for emergencies such as the changes and alterations. If you need some accessories and fittings to be added to the dress, you can if you plan early.

The second tip that is supposed to reply to the above mentioned two questions or hypothesis. And it would be big money saver too. Nowadays, less and less brides wear the same dress throughout the wedding and the reception. More and more brides make changes between the parts of the wedding reception. Do you think they bought them all? No way. They rent them. Each time you make a change will bring the guests a new impression. You do want to show all of the beautiful you to others during your day, right? So why no rent your wedding? This way you don’t have to go through the pains of choosing among those of which you like all.

To show the most beautiful aspects of you on your wedding day which endows you the right naturally, you should undoubtedly start looking for the bridal wedding dress early. Other than having to select one, rent all of those that you like. With these two tips, there should be no more issues with your bridal wedding dress.
